In Veranillo there were lots of hills. People built their houses on the mountains and hills. Granddaddy's wood house Sat on top of a hill, it had an outhouse, I was scared of using that toilet,  I saw maggots and spiders in there thankfully, a new bathroom was being built at that time.
Because the houses were built on the hills the water took a long time to reach the top. So during the day we wouldn't have any water until night time then it would have a powerful flow. At midnight each day we would fill every container, gallons and pots with water, sometimes it would be a whole day or two before the water would reach the top, on those days we would have to go to the lower part of the town to some relatives house and tow water back to granddaddy's house on the hill, man we worked hard.
